About Gaming Law in Germiston, South Africa:

Gaming in Germiston, South Africa is regulated by various laws and regulations to ensure fair play and protect the interests of both players and operators. In Germiston, gaming activities encompass a wide range of activities, including casinos, online gambling, sports betting, and more.

Local Laws Overview:

In Germiston, South Africa, gaming activities are governed by the National Gambling Act of 2004 and the National Gambling Regulations. These laws regulate various aspects of gaming, including licensing requirements, player protections, advertising restrictions, and more. It is important to comply with these laws to avoid legal consequences.

Frequently Asked Questions:

Q: What is the legal age for gambling in Germiston, South Africa?

A: The legal age for gambling in Germiston, South Africa is 18 years old.

Q: Are online gambling sites legal in Germiston?

A: Online gambling sites are legal in Germiston, as long as they are licensed and regulated by the relevant authorities.

Q: Can I operate a casino in Germiston without a license?

A: No, operating a casino in Germiston without a license is illegal and can result in severe penalties.
